In a thrilling development that promises to redefine the competitive landscape of the ABB FIA Formula E World Championship, Lola Cars has announced its much-anticipated return to the racing circuit. The iconic brand is not just making a comeback but is doing so with a bang, by forming a strategic partnership with Yamaha and ABT. This trio of powerhouses is geared up to take the electric racing world by storm, starting with the next season of Formula E.

Yamaha: Breaking New Ground

Yamaha's decision to re-enter four-wheel racing after a hiatus since 1997 is equally groundbreaking. Renowned for their prowess in motorcycle racing, Yamaha's move to join forces with Lola Cars and ABT for the Formula E challenge marks a significant pivot towards embracing the future of automotive racing technologies. This transition is not just a testament to Yamaha's versatile engineering capabilities but also signals a fresh chapter in their storied racing legacy.

A Triumvirate of Talent: Lola, Yamaha, and ABT

The collaboration between Lola, Yamaha, and ABT is a strategic power play within the competitive arena of Formula E racing. ABT brings to the table a wealth of experience and a track record of success within the Formula E ecosystem. This partnership is set to benefit from ABT's in-depth understanding of the series, providing Lola and Yamaha with invaluable insights and a competitive edge. The Lola/Yamaha collaboration focuses on developing a groundbreaking powertrain for the Gen3.5 Formula E machines. This ambitious project aims not only to push the boundaries of what's possible within electric vehicle racing but also to enhance the performance capabilities of Formula E cars significantly. The goal is clear: to augment the prowess and efficiency of these high-speed machines, setting new standards for the future of the sport.

Industry Reactions

The enthusiasm and optimism surrounding this collaboration are palpable. Thomas Biermaier, expressing his delight, stated, "We are delighted to have found two renowned partners for our future in Formula E." This sentiment is echoed by Till Bechtolsheimer, who highlighted ABT's crucial role, saying, "Operating factory-backed programmes is ABT’s bread and butter, and their experience in Formula E will give us a critical leg up." These statements reflect the strategic nature of the alliance and the collective ambition to not just compete but also to redefine the benchmarks of success in the Formula E series.
